The Residential Counselor will provide an evening presence, doing regular rounds throughout the building, being available to tenants as necessary, assisting with regular daily tenant wellness checks, observing and upholding the rights of tenants, overseeing occupancy agreement and house rule compliance, setting limits when appropriate, and providing crisis intervention as necessary. Counselors will contribute to the physical upkeep of the building by noting any housekeeping or maintenance issues that arise during their shift, resolving these problems where possible, and forwarding concerns to appropriate staff for later resolution when necessary.
Occasional daytime availability will be required for training, meetings and other obligations. This person will be an important member of a team, which has as its goal assisting our tenants achieve the very highest possible quality of life.
